Java float Keyword

❮ Java Keywords

Example

float myNum = 5.75f; System.out.println(myNum);

Try it Yourself »

Definition and Usage

The float keyword is a data type that can store fractional numbers from 3.4e−038 to 3.4e+038.

Note that you should end the value with an "f":
